Correct answer: A — Resuscitate and obtain emergency CT and neurosurgical advice
The best answer is “Resuscitate and obtain emergency CT and neurosurgical advice”. Neurological deterioration and anisocoria indicate possible expanding intracranial haemorrhage or herniation. Immediate ABC management, urgent CT and neurosurgical discussion are required; treatment for raised intracranial pressure may be needed during transfer. Earlier reassuring findings do not protect against evolving bleeding.
